Brendan Leonard to lead Sligo GAA in 2019



Brendan Leonard was elected as Sligo GAA’s new Chaireperson at Wednesday night’s Annual Convention in the Radisson Blu Hotel.

The Tourlestrane clubman was elected ahead of Gerry O’Connor (St Pat’s) and he succeeds Joe Taaffe who stood down from the post after completing his five-year stint.

Taaffe will continue to sit on the County Executive in 2019, having been elected to the postiion of Vice-Treasurer.

Declan Rouse from the Enniscrone/Kilglass club is the new Vice-Chair, while Castleconnor’s Bart Barrins is the new PRO after he defeated Bunninadden’s Keith Henry in an election.

Sligo GAA County Board 2019
Chairperson: Brendan Leonard
Vice-Chair: Declan Rouse
Secretary: Bernadine McGauran
Assistant Secretary: Seán Carroll
Treasurer: Peter Greene
Assistant Treasurer: Joe Taffe
Coaching Officer: John McPartland
Cultural Officer: Dermot Gannon
Children’s Officer: Terrance Marren
PRO: Bart Barrins
Central Council: John Murphy
Connacht Council delegates: Gerry O’Connor & John Niland.
